The annual salary statistics of speech-language pathologists in Sumter, South Carolina is shown in Table 1. The wage data of speech-language pathologists in Sumter is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
|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th Percentile Wage | $49,580 |
| 25th Percentile Wage | $54,540 |
| 50th Percentile Wage | $59,670 |
| 75th Percentile Wage | $64,800 |
| 90th Percentile Wage | $89,740 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for speech-language pathologists in Sumter, South Carolina in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$89,740.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$59,670.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$49,580.
